For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 331 students in United Community School District. This district's average testing ranking is 7/10, which is in the top 50% of public schools in Iowa.
Public School in United Community School District have an average math proficiency score of 72% (versus the Iowa public school average of 68%), and reading proficiency score of 77% (versus the 70%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 10%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Iowa public school average of 29%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$25,245 is higher than the state median of $16,468. The school district revenue/student has grown by 12%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$25,849 is higher than the state median of $16,042. The school district spending/student has grown by 26% over four school years.
